Project Goldie

I've been wanting to find a Truck to Daily drive so i can dive into my 67 a little more with having to worry about having it put back together the next day. Today I picked up Goldie a 1970 long box with a 307 and 3ott. Plans are to clean it up a bit fix a few rust spots Change the wheels and lower it a little bit. I love the patina on it and want to keep as much of that as I can.

Well I've owned the truck for a week and a half now and a couple gremlins have already popped up. I kind of expected it though because the truck had sat for a while at the previous owners house. It's going to need a complete front to back break job and 4 new tires. On Sunday in a matter of a hr a rear wheel cylinder blew and a belt broke on one of the tires and the tread seperated. The other three tires look like they are about ready to do the same. Pay day it will be getting $400 in new tires. Pay day after that new breaks and payday after that a tune up. then a Quick buff job a detail and I can put a for sale sign it to free up some money for the new motor in my 67

Got a little done today. Got the wheel Bearing fixed. 4 new drums, shoes, wheel Cylinders hardware kit. Still need to change the master cylinder and put the new tires on the Rally wheels My buddy 62longbed gave me. Also found a Grill and chrome front bumper and cap and rings I need to go pick up.
